Mouthguard made at least partially from an edible candy
A mouthguard includes a U-shaped upper bite plate which removably fits over upper teeth of a person, with the entire upper bite plate being made from a soft, deformable and edible gummi candy.
Make the Most of PatentStorm
See this month's Top Inventors and Most Cited Patents.
Stay on top of the latest patents by subscribing to an RSS feed.
Got questions? Ask a Patent Expert!
Registered users: Manage your profile, comments and alerts.
| Number | Title | Issue Date |
| 7680895 | Integrated conversations having both email and chat messages Email and chat messages may be displayed as part of the same conversation, in an integrated conversation view. The conversation view would include items corresponding to email messages that are part of the conversation and chat messages that are part of the conversa... | 03/16/2010 |
| 7673007 | Web services push gateway A system and method for interfacing Web Services push applications and mobile terminals operable with one of a plurality of different mobile push technologies. A Web Services push gateway includes a Web Services endpoint to terminate Web Services protocols utilized ... | 03/02/2010 |
| 7668922 | Identifying and displaying relevant shared entities in an instant messaging system An apparatus, program product and/or method identify relevant shared entities and/or display shared entities in an instant messaging system. In particular, entities such as files, images, videos, e-mails, links, bookmarks, databases, transcripts of other instant mes... | 02/23/2010 |
| 7664822 | Systems and methods for authentication of target protocol screen names A protocol management system is capable of detecting certain message protocols and applying policy rules to the detected message protocols that prevent intrusion, or abuse, of a network's resources. In one aspect, a protocol message gateway is configured to apply po... | 02/16/2010 |
| 7660865 | Spam filtering with probabilistic secure hashes Disclosed are signature-based systems and methods that facilitate spam detection and prevention at least in part by calculating hash values for an incoming message and then determining a probability that the hash values indicate spam. In particular, the signatures g... | 02/09/2010 |
| 7660863 | Confidence communication method between two units A method for communication between a first unit and a second unit via a telecommunications network, wherein the first unit comprises a first family of applications and a second family of applications having communication capacities on the network extending beyond co... | 02/09/2010 |
| 7660864 | System and method for user notification Systems and methods applicable, for example, in having a node inform its user of one or more events while the user interface of the node is in an idle state. The user might, for instance, be able to select one or more of the events of which she is informed for corre... | 02/09/2010 |
| 7657605 | Presence enhanced online processes In some embodiments, a managed presence online processing system may include one or more of the following features: (a) a memory comprising, (i) presence information submitted from a user, and (ii) a presence online processing program that initiates online processes... | 02/02/2010 |
| 7650385 | Assigning priorities Disclosed is a technique for assigning priorities. A request to manipulate data is received. A type of the request is determined. A priority is assigned to the request based on the type of the request. ... | 01/19/2010 |
| 7647383 | Intelligent message deletion In accordance with certain aspects of the intelligent message deletion, a system includes a message queue and an intelligent deletion module. The intelligent message deletion module adds a newly received message to the message queue and deletes a previously received... | 01/12/2010 |
| 7644129 | Persistence of common reliable messaging data Method and system for processing single WS-RM sequence by a plurality of clustered application server instances, sharing persisted RM sequence data related to WS-RM protocol. The common RM sequence data, associated with a plurality of RM requests is cached in a buff... | 01/05/2010 |
| 7634546 | System and method for communication within a community A communications tool that combines a software application and various communication systems that parallel natural styles of knowledge sharing and problem solving. It merges with normal patterns of relationship to create a seamless and transparent extension of commu... | 12/15/2009 |
| 7631047 | Systems and methods for providing critical information based on profile data Systems and methods for providing critical information to a user of a content providing service based on profile data associated with the user are disclosed. Such systems and methods can include storing a user profile that identifies a plurality of communication pat... | 12/08/2009 |
| 7631049 | Content providing device and device for browsing provided content A teleconference system is large-scale. In the present invention, an IM server provides instant message service to a first client, a second client and a content providing device. The first client adds position information of a first cursor to an instant message and ... | 12/08/2009 |
| 7631048 | Method and system for personal policy-controlled automated response to information transfer requests A user's computer system sends a policy controlled response to an information request from a requesting computing system. A user policy is set by the user, and the user policy defines parameters, i.e. rules and values, for use in controlling the response information... | 12/08/2009 |
| 7617287 | Cellular messaging alert method and system An efficient method and system for utilizing existing wireless communication devices and networks, such as cellular phones and carriers, as an underlying infrastructure in providing emergency information to a targeted percentage of the population in a specified geog... | 11/10/2009 |
| 7606866 | Messenger assistant for personal information management A real-time communications device, a real-time communications system of networked distributed such devices and method and program product for operating such devices. The device includes a personal information manager (PIM), an instant messenger and a Messenger Assis... | 10/20/2009 |
| 7603426 | Flexible context management for enumeration sessions using context exchange Mechanisms for providing requested data items in a request-driven enumeration session while retaining control over how much inter-message context information is retained by the data provider. Upon receiving a request for the data items, the data provider identifies ... | 10/13/2009 |
| 7603427 | System and method for defining, refining, and personalizing communications policies in a notification platform A system and method is provided for personalizing and refining policies within a general notification platform. The system includes a profile definition and selection system that receives contextual information relating to a user state. The profile definition and se... | 10/13/2009 |
| 7590701 | Apparatus and method for generating alert messages in a message exchange network A method of operating a message exchange network is described. In one embodiment, the method includes coordinating a message generated by a message sender with a message recipient. The method also includes detecting an event asssociated with the message. The method ... | 09/15/2009 |
| 7587460 | Data processing apparatus for generating reduced images of transmission images or reduced data of transmission data in list form and control method thereof Read images are stored and images to be transmitted are selected. When the selected images are transmitted, list data listing a group of reduced images of the images is generated. The generated list data is printed, displayed, or otherwise output, allowing a user to... | 09/08/2009 |
| 7587461 | Method and system for activity based email sorting Messages of a user are ranked based on metrics derived from user actions with regard to the messages. Groupings of messages, such as conversations or a set of messages that are determined to be similar, may also be ranked. When new messages are received, their inter... | 09/08/2009 |
| 7587462 | Method and apparatus for distributing notification among cooperating devices and device channels Methods and devices for networked applications are disclosed. In one embodiment, a device instructs a proxy server to receive traffic inbound for the device, and to notify the device when such traffic arrives. The device can then sleep, except for a notification cha... | 09/08/2009 |
| 7577712 | Efficient event completion in UDAPL A technique in accordance with one embodiment of the invention uses an adaptive algorithm to obtain UDAPL event messages. According to one aspect, a process repetitively performs the following steps as long as the process expects to receive at least one event messag... | 08/18/2009 |
| 7577711 | Chat room communication network implementation enabling senders to restrict the display of messages to the chat room chronological displays of only designated recipients A participant in an instant messaging chat room may send restricted messages to only a set of selected participants in the chat room. Enabling a user at a display station to select a set of only users to receive a restricted message, and send the restricted message ... | 08/18/2009 |
| 7577710 | System and method for prioritizing electronic mail and controlling spam The present system and method for prioritizing email and controlling spam provides capability to determine the priority of emails received by an addressee. Such emails are designed to alert an addressee of its priority by the number of times the characters of the em... | 08/18/2009 |
| 7574479 | Techniques for attesting to content Techniques for attesting to content received from an author (sender) are provided. A sender's content is represented by a message digest. The message digest is signed by an identity service. The signed message digest represents an attestation as to the authenticity ... | 08/11/2009 |
| 7571214 | System and method for controlling distribution of network communications A method for controlling distribution of network communications (messages). An incoming message either carries priority information, or is assigned priority information based on a shared characteristic with other messages. The priority information is used to determi... | 08/04/2009 |
| 7568012 | Method and device for forwarding short messages from a mobile terminal Short messages sent by a mobile terminal from a foreign network are routed to an external short-message entity. An external short-message entity, which runs on a computer in a data network, is reached from a mobile telephone from any desired foreign network. The inq... | 07/28/2009 |
| 7568013 | Multiple message send routine for network packets A method for sending a plurality of messages to a plurality of recipients including obtaining the plurality of messages for the plurality of recipients, grouping the plurality of messages into a data structure, generating a system call from a user-level application ... | 07/28/2009 |
| 7558833 | Method and system for selectively forwarding electronic-mail A method for selectively forwarding e-mail comprising receiving a first e-mail message at a first receiving host system from an originator at a sending host system. The first e-mail message is addressed to a recipient at a first mailbox on the first receiving host s... | 07/07/2009 |
| 7558834 | Method and system to process issue data pertaining to a system A computer-implemented method processes issue data pertaining to a system. Issue data is received from a reporting entity, the issue data identifying an issue pertaining to the system and the reporting entity. A database is accessed to retrieve performance data rega... | 07/07/2009 |
| 7552186 | Method and system for filtering spam using an adjustable reliability value A spam detection system can monitor incoming and outgoing email messages and prevent email messages from being delivered. This spam detection system incorporates a sender ranking system that maintains prior sender's email addresses and an associated reliability valu... | 06/23/2009 |
| 7548956 | Spam control based on sender account characteristics The characteristics of a communications account are used to determine whether the account is being used by a spammer. When the account is being used by a spammer, the use of the account for outgoing communications is limited to help prevent spam from being sent from... | 06/16/2009 |
| 7543035 | Network that converts data from a first format into a second format for communication, data communication apparatus capable of communication of data in a first format, communication system incorporating all the above, and control method for all the above In a communication system having a network capable of converting data in a first format into data in a second format to perform communication, and a data communication apparatus capable of performing communication of the data in the first format, the data communicat... | 06/02/2009 |
| 7543036 | System and method for controlling distribution of network communications A method for controlling distribution of network communications (messages). An incoming message either carries priority information, or is assigned priority information based on a shared characteristic with other messages. The priority information is used to determi... | 06/02/2009 |
| 7543034 | Instant messenger reflector A system and method are provided for establishing an Instant Messenger (IM) reflector service. The method comprises: establishing an interface between an IM network server and an IM master client identified with a first username; establishing a reflector service bet... | 06/02/2009 |
| 7536442 | Method, system, and storage medium for providing autonomic identification of an important message An exemplary embodiment of the invention relates to a method, system, and storage medium for providing autonomic identification of an important message addressed to a recipient email subscriber. The method includes scanning an email message received over a network o... | 05/19/2009 |
| 7519676 | Methods for and applications of learning and inferring the periods of time until people are available or unavailable for different forms of communication, collaboration, and information access A system and method are provided to learn and infer the time until a user will be available for communications, collaboration, or information access, given evidence about such observations as time of day, calendar, location, presence, and activity. The methods can b... | 04/14/2009 |
| 7512662 | System and method for user registry management of messages A system and method for providing user registry management of instant messages is disclosed. The system allows recipients to set filter criteria for filtering instant messages, the filter criteria being selected from a database of characteristics, or registry, for s... | 03/31/2009 |